Where is Carman, Manitoba?
Carman is located along highway(s) 3 and is approximately 80 kilometres south west of Manitoba's capital city (Winnipeg) and is 107 kilometres to a 24 hour U.S. border crossing at Emerson.

Accommodations
Carman will be rolling out the welcome mat for athletes, coaches and spectators alike! Athletes and coaches will be staying in the athletes village (the local schools). If you are planning to visit Carman as a spectator, several options for lodging are available to you.
